This leadership role within the Application Modernization practice focuses on guiding clients through the transformation of their application portfolios, with a strong emphasis on direct, hands-on technical contribution and execution. The ideal candidate will possess deep expertise in modern application architectures, cloud-native technologies, and modernization strategies, leading engagements from strategy through technical implementation, coding, and solution delivery, while also driving business development and contributing to the practice's growth.
Responsibilities
- Client Engagement and Project Leadership:
- Facilitate application portfolio assessment, modernization strategy development, target architecture design (including microservices, serverless, containerization), roadmap creation, and planning workshops.
- Lead discovery sessions to deeply understand client business objectives, pain points, existing application landscape (including legacy systems), and technical constraints.
- Ensure client expectations regarding modernization outcomes (e.g., cost savings, agility, scalability), timelines, technical approaches, and potential challenges are clearly defined and managed.
- Actively engage in hands-on technical delivery, including writing code, configuring cloud services, building proof-of-concepts (PoCs), and performing complex integrations related to application modernization.
- Lead technical project teams in delivering Application Modernization consulting services and implementation projects, covering various modernization patterns (e.g., Rehost, Replatform, Refactor, Rearchitect, Rebuild, Replace), with a focus on technical leadership and execution.
- Drive and manage project objectives, gather detailed functional and non-functional requirements for modernized applications, track project tasks/milestones, manage status reporting, identify dependencies, and ensure engagements deliver tangible business value through successful modernization, on time.
- Break down complex application modernization challenges into manageable workstreams, identify key factors (e.g., technical debt, data migration complexity, organizational change readiness), and determine the optimal modernization approach for specific applications or portfolios.
- Perform final review, editing, and sign-off on project deliverables such as assessment findings, modernization strategy documents, target state architecture blueprints, migration plans, and critically, hands-on code reviews and working PoC results.
- Present modernization strategies, proposed architectures, project updates, and final deliverables effectively to both technical stakeholders and client executive management.
- Lead, mentor, and guide consultants and client team members, including pair programming and technical guidance on specific implementation challenges, fostering best practices in modern software development, cloud-native principles, and specific modernization techniques.

Qualifications
- Significant, demonstrable experience leading large-scale application transformation and modernization engagements for enterprise clients, with a strong portfolio of hands-on technical contributions and delivered solutions.
- Deep expertise and practical knowledge across key areas of Application Modernization:
- Modernization Strategies & Patterns:
- Strong understanding and application of the 6 R's (Rehost, Replatform, Refactor, Rearchitect, Rebuild, Replace), Domain-Driven Design (DDD), and Strangler Fig pattern.
- Application Portfolio Assessment: Proven ability to analyze complex application landscapes, assess technical debt, identify modernization candidates, determine business value, and estimate effort/risk.
- Cloud-Native Architecture & Development: Expert-level proficiency in designing and hands-on building applications using microservices, APIs, event-driven patterns, serverless functions (FaaS), containerization (Docker, Kubernetes), and associated management/orchestration tools. Proven ability to write production-ready code in this context.
- Cloud Platforms (Azure, AWS, GCP): In-depth knowledge and hands-on experience with relevant application services on at least one major cloud platform, including compute options (VMs, Containers, Serverless), managed databases (SQL/NoSQL), messaging queues, API gateways, monitoring, and security services.
- DevOps & DevSecOps: Solid understanding andextensive practical experience with implementing and optimizingCI/CD pipelines, infrastructure as code (IaC - Terraform, CloudFormation, ARM templates), automated testing strategies (unit, integration, E2E), code security scanning, and observability (logging, metrics, tracing) in the context of application lifecycles.
- Programming Languages/Frameworks: Deep hands-on proficiency with common enterprise languages and frameworks (e.g., Java/Spring Boot, .NET Core/Framework, Python/Django/Flask, Node.js) and extensive experience addressing challenges in modernizing applications built with them. Ability to read, write, and debug complex code.
- Database Modernization: Knowledge of strategies and techniques for migrating and modernizing relational and non-relational databases alongside application changes, including practical experience with database migrations and schema evolution.
- Legacy Systems: Experience working with and understanding the challenges of modernizing monolithic applications, mainframe systems (desirable), or applications built on older technology stacks.
- Strong understanding and practical application of Agile methodologies (Scrum, Kanban) and modern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C) principles, with a focus on delivering working software iteratively.
